Understanding Stage 5 Maladie rénale chronique

Scène 5 CKD occurs when the kidneys have lost 85% or more of their function. The kidneys play a crucial role in filtering waste products from the blood, regulating blood pressure, and producing essential hormones. In Stage 5 CKD, these functions are severely impaired, leading to a buildup of toxins, fluid retention, and electrolyte imbalances. Patients with Stage 5 CKD require dialysis or kidney transplantation to survive.

Le rôle des cellules souches dans la régénération rénale

Les cellules souches sont des cellules indifférenciées qui ont le potentiel de se développer en différents types de cellules spécialisées. Dans le contexte de CKD, Les cellules souches offrent la possibilité de régénérer les tissus rénaux endommagés et de restaurer la fonction rénale. Thérapie par cellules souches involves harvesting stem cells from the patients own body or from a donor, then transplanting them into the kidneys. Once transplanted, the stem cells have the potential to differentiate into new kidney cells, repairing damaged tissue and improving kidney function.
